Create a Propaganda Poster Project

Created by
Cynthia Hansen
Use this project after a lesson on propaganda to check students’ understanding of propaganda techniques. Assign each student a subject for their propaganda posters. I put the subject ideas in a hat and have the students draw. Suggestions for subjects are given. Students choose a propaganda technique, write a slogan, preplan a poster, then draw a final poster. Students write a paragraph to explain why they chose the propaganda technique. A grading rubric is included. CCSS: RI 2, 3, 4, 6, 7
